What is a fraud strategy?

A Fraud Strategy job involves analyzing fraud risks, developing policies, and implementing strategies to prevent and mitigate fraudulent activities. Professionals in this role use data analysis, machine learning models, and industry trends to detect suspicious patterns and enhance fraud prevention measures. They collaborate with risk management, compliance, and operational teams to optimize fraud detection while minimizing customer friction. This role requires a mix of analytical skills, strategic thinking, and knowledge of fraud schemes and prevention techniques.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als in fraud strategy roles?

Professionals in Fraud Strategy roles often navigate rapidly evolving techniques used by fraudsters, requiring continuous learning and adaptability. Collaborating with multiple departments—such as compliance, IT, and operations—demands strong communication and project management skills to ensure alignment on anti-fraud initiatives. Balancing the need for thorough fraud prevention with a seamless customer experience can present unique challenges. Staying up-to-date with regulatory changes and industry best practices is also crucial to maintaining effective fraud defenses.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the fraud strategy position, and why are they important?

To excel in Fraud Strategy, you need strong analytical skills, risk assessment expertise, and a background in finance, business, or data science are often required. Experience with fraud detection platforms, data analytics tools like SQL and Python, and certifications such as CFE (Certified Fraud Examiner) are highly valued. Excellent problem-solving abilities, communication, and the capacity to work cross-functionally are standout soft skills in this role. These competencies are critical for identifying emerging fraud trends, developing effective countermeasures, and ensuring business integrity.

About the Role:


As the Manager, Underwriting at Bluevine, you will lead and develop a high-performing team of underwriters responsible for making sound credit decisions, including evaluating new loan applications, credit line increases, and escalated underwriting cases. As a subject matter expert in cash flow underwriting, you will play a key role in driving underwriting consistency, decision quality, operational excellence, and continuous process improvement across Credit Operations.


In this role, you will coach, mentor, and develop your team while balancing day-to-day underwriting responsibilities and contributing to strategic initiatives that support Bluevine's continued growth. You'll partner closely with cross-functional teams to refine underwriting processes, improve automation, and help build a world-class lending organization that empowers small businesses with the working capital they need to start, run, and grow their businesses.What You'll Do:



  • Lead and develop a global underwriting team, driving consistency, decision quality, and SLA performance, while maintaining an individual case queue workload.

  • Partner with cross-functional teams on special projects and strategic initiatives as needed.

  • Partner with the Head of Credit Operations and cross-functional stakeholders to optimize underwriting workflows, improve queue management, and drive operational efficiencies.

  • Build and maintain a strong understanding of Bluevine's credit models, policies, and systems to support the development of underwriting tools, processes, and best practices.

  • Partner with the fraud team to identify emerging fraud trends across new applications and the existing portfolio, implementing process improvements to minimize losses.

  • Collaborate with risk operations leadership to identify and implement automation opportunities that improve scalability, efficiency, and the customer experience.

  • Build strong cross-functional relationships and influence stakeholders across other business teams.

  • Maintain SLAs while ensuring a high-quality customer experience through effective communication and collaboration across departments.
